Transaction f39611e763735845638afebb3eee6f755f2d264b280937fd24c612df4d9a577e

1 Input
2 Outputs
  • f39611e763735845638afebb3eee6f755f2d264b280937fd24c612df4d9a577e:0
  • value  71353065
    address  34uW7iszpAYHDiUWegcLdiarajh6s9vVhC
  • f39611e763735845638afebb3eee6f755f2d264b280937fd24c612df4d9a577e:1
  • value  301200
    address  1Piqkbuu7P859CmoRT36RAwBAC5DAy63ng